Методы создания SSL-сертификатов с помощью Terraform: подробное руководство

Вот несколько методов, которые можно использовать для создания SSL-сертификата с помощью Terraform:

  1. Используйте ресурс «tls_private_key» в Terraform для создания закрытого ключа и самозаверяющего сертификата. Этот метод подходит для целей разработки и тестирования.

  2. Используйте поставщика центра сертификации (CA), например Let’s Encrypt или AWS Certificate Manager, в своей конфигурации Terraform. Эти поставщики могут автоматизировать выдачу сертификатов SSL и управление ими.

  3. Включите внешний инструмент, например OpenSSL, для создания сертификата SSL и закрытого ключа вне Terraform. Затем вы можете ссылаться на эти файлы в своей конфигурации Terraform.

  4. Если у вас уже есть существующий сертификат SSL, вы можете импортировать его в Terraform, используя ресурсы «aws_acm_certificate» или «aws_iam_server_certificate», в зависимости от используемого вами провайдера.